DK Dance Productions • Owner, Darci Ward
“Darci is a super insightful and fun person, and everyone can learn a thing or two from her.” - Ian Lohr (CEO Student)

Darci is a perfect example of an entrepreneur that started small and grew her business from one studio with 50 students to now three studios with 600+ students.
She is a former Miss Jersey County and when you meet her it is easy to see why she would be chosen to represent our county. She is well-spoken, smart, and always has a smile on her face.

Darci started dancing at the age of three and has always had a passion for it. She taught dance for twenty years and is now the owner operator of her three studios in Florisant, Alton, and Jerseyville.
To keep up with the demands of being a business owner, she wakes up at 4:30AM and has a daily morning routine that includes reading and working out.

Her biggest influences were the two strongest women she has known - her mom and grandma. If they didn't know how to do something they would figure it out.

Darci is a CEO mentor for the fifth time this year. We are so grateful for the time she dedicates to this program and the students. She always gives students the book “The Compound Effect”. This book made an impact on her and she hopes it also encourages students that they can achieve great things if they keep trying and gain momentum.
